Exploring the Mechanism of Action of Buspar in Bipolar Disorder
Bipolar disorder presents a complex interplay of neurotransmitter dysregulation, requiring nuanced pharmacological interventions for effective management. In this context, understanding the mechanism of action of Buspar, a medication primarily indicated for anxiety but also explored for its potential in bipolar disorder, is paramount.
Buspar, chemically known as buspirone, operates through a multifaceted mechanism within the central nervous system (CNS). Unlike conventional anxiolytics such as benzodiazepines, which target gamma-aminobutyric acid (GABA) receptors, Buspar exerts its effects by modulating serotonin receptors, specifically the 5-HT1A subtype. This unique pharmacological profile renders it an intriguing candidate for adjunctive therapy in bipolar disorder, where serotonin dysregulation is implicated alongside other neurotransmitter imbalances.
Buspar’s mechanism of action primarily involves agonism at serotonin receptors, notably the 5-HT1A subtype, distinguishing it from traditional anxiolytics.
Upon binding to 5-HT1A receptors, Buspar elicits downstream effects that include both presynaptic autoreceptor desensitization and postsynaptic receptor activation. This dual action ultimately leads to a modulation of serotonin neurotransmission, contributing to its anxiolytic and, potentially, mood-stabilizing properties.
- Buspar’s action on 5-HT1A receptors results in presynaptic autoreceptor desensitization.
- Postsynaptic receptor activation further contributes to its modulation of serotonin neurotransmission.
Moreover, Buspar’s pharmacological profile suggests a favorable side effect profile compared to traditional mood stabilizers, offering a potential adjunctive option with reduced risk of sedation, cognitive impairment, and dependence.

Addressing Anxiety Symptoms in Bipolar Disorder with Buspar
Patients diagnosed with bipolar disorder often experience symptoms beyond the classic mood swings, including debilitating anxiety. Managing anxiety in bipolar disorder is crucial for overall treatment efficacy and patient well-being. While traditional medications like mood stabilizers and antipsychotics are the cornerstone of bipolar treatment, they may not sufficiently address anxiety symptoms. In such cases, adjunctive therapy with medications specifically targeting anxiety, such as Buspar, can be beneficial.
Anxiety in bipolar disorder presents a unique challenge due to its fluctuating nature and its potential to exacerbate mood episodes. This comorbidity can significantly impair daily functioning and worsen the course of the illness if left untreated. Buspar, also known by its generic name buspirone, is a non-benzodiazepine anxiolytic that works differently from traditional anti-anxiety medications. Unlike benzodiazepines, which act on the gamma-aminobutyric acid (GABA) receptors in the brain, Buspar primarily targets serotonin receptors, specifically the 5-HT1A subtype.

Potential Side Effects and Considerations of Using Buspar in Bipolar Disorder Treatment
Buspar, a medication primarily prescribed for anxiety disorders, has been considered for adjunctive use in managing bipolar disorder symptoms. However, while it may offer some benefits in specific cases, it’s essential to be mindful of potential side effects and factors to consider before incorporating it into a treatment regimen.
Before delving into the specifics of Buspar usage in bipolar disorder, it’s crucial to understand the potential side effects associated with this medication. Like any pharmaceutical intervention, Buspar comes with its own set of considerations that patients and healthcare providers should be aware of.
- Gastrointestinal Disturbances: Some individuals may experience gastrointestinal upset, such as nausea or stomach discomfort, when taking Buspar.
- Dizziness or Drowsiness: Another common side effect is dizziness or drowsiness, which can impair cognitive function and coordination. Patients should be cautious, especially when engaging in activities that require mental alertness, such as driving or operating machinery.
It’s essential for patients to communicate openly with their healthcare provider regarding any side effects experienced during Buspar treatment.
Furthermore, it’s vital to consider potential drug interactions when incorporating Buspar into a bipolar disorder treatment plan. Certain medications, such as monoamine oxidase inhibitors (MAOIs) or selective serotonin reuptake inhibitors (SSRIs), may interact with Buspar, leading to adverse effects or decreased efficacy.
